当前位置:首页 » 行业资讯 » 周边资讯 » 正文

揭秘HTTP Cookies:深入了解其工作原理与用途

揭秘HTTPCookies:深入了解其工作原理与用途

随着互联网技术的快速发展,HTTPCookies已经成为了现代网页开发中不可或缺的一部分。

无论是访问社交媒体网站,进行在线购物,还是浏览各类新闻网站,Cookies都在默默地发挥着它们的作用。

那么,究竟什么是HTTP Cookies?它们是如何工作的?又有哪些用途呢?本文将为您深入解析HTTP Cookies的工作原理和用途。

一、HTTP Cookies的定义

HTTP Cookies是一种由网站服务器发送到用户浏览器的小型数据文本文件。

当用户在浏览器中访问某个网站时,服务器可以通过Cookies记录用户的活动、偏好以及身份等信息。

这些信息在用户的后续访问中会再次被发送到服务器,从而实现用户与服务器之间的状态保持。

简单来说,Cookies就是服务器与浏览器之间的一种通信机制。

二、HTTP Cookies的工作原理

HTTP Cookies的工作原理可以概括为以下三个步骤:

1.创建Cookies:当用户首次访问某个网站时,服务器会在响应头中返回一个Set-Cookie指令,告诉浏览器创建一个Cookies。这个指令包含了Cookies的名称、值以及其他一些属性,如过期时间、路径等。

2. 存储Cookies:浏览器接收到Set-Cookie指令后,会在用户本地存储这个Cookies。在之后的访问中,浏览器会自动将存储的Cookies信息添加到HTTP请求头中,发送给服务器。

3. 识别用户:服务器通过识别请求头中的Cookies信息,可以确认用户的身份,从而为用户提供定制化的内容或服务。

三、HTTP Cookies的用途

HTTP Cookies的用途非常广泛,主要包括以下几个方面:

1. 会话管理:通过Cookies,网站可以识别用户的身份,实现用户的登录状态管理。用户在网站的各个页面之间跳转时,网站可以通过识别Cookies信息来保持用户的会话状态,避免用户重新登录。

2. 个性化服务:Cookies还可以记录用户的偏好设置,如语言、字体、地理位置等。当用户再次访问网站时,网站可以根据这些信息为用户提供定制化的内容或服务。例如,电商平台可以根据用户的购物记录和偏好推荐相关产品。

3. 数据分析:通过Cookies,网站可以收集用户的访问数据,如访问时间、访问路径、点击行为等。这些数据对于网站的优化和改进非常重要,可以帮助网站了解用户的习惯和需求,从而提高用户体验和网站的运营效率。

4. 跟踪与广告:很多网站会利用Cookies进行用户跟踪,以便在用户浏览其他网站时投放相关的广告。这种跟踪通常是通过第三方Cookies来实现的,但这也引发了关于用户隐私的担忧。因此,在使用这类技术时,网站需要遵循相关的法律法规,确保用户的隐私安全。

5. 保障安全:在某些情况下,Cookies还可以用于提高网站的安全性。例如,某些网站会使用Cookies来实施防暴力攻击策略,限制同一账号在短时间内登录的次数。

四、总结

HTTP Cookies是现代互联网技术中不可或缺的一部分,它们在提高用户体验、优化网站运营以及保障网络安全等方面发挥着重要作用。

随着人们对隐私保护意识的提高,Cookies的使用也引发了一些争议。

因此,在使用Cookies时,我们需要遵循相关的法律法规,尊重用户的隐私权益,确保技术的合法、正当和透明使用。

同时,我们也需要不断学习和研究新技术,以更好地利用Cookies为我们的生活和工作带来便利。

未经允许不得转载:虎跃云 » 揭秘HTTP Cookies:深入了解其工作原理与用途
分享到
0
上一篇
下一篇

相关推荐

联系我们

huhuidc

复制已复制
262730666复制已复制
13943842618复制已复制
262730666@qq.com复制已复制
0438-7280666复制已复制
微信公众号
huyueidc_com复制已复制
关注官方微信,了解最新资讯
客服微信
huhuidc复制已复制
商务号,添加请说明来意
contact-img
客服QQ
262730666复制已复制
商务号,添加请说明来意
在线咨询
13943842618复制已复制
工作时间:8:30-12:00;13:30-18:00
客服邮箱
服务热线
0438-7280666复制已复制
24小时服务热线